Output ebfed3933c5b072c7a231a53f34ff2acc569a9beaadf3f097891f92202befc6a:59

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 b0ecc80a5f0fd129876f0022203a95df9e0c65e4
address
bc1qkrkvszjlplgjnpm0qq3zqw54m70qce0yts9gu2
transaction
ebfed3933c5b072c7a231a53f34ff2acc569a9beaadf3f097891f92202befc6a